Articles

Dr Jo is a Sydney Morning Herald Opinions writer, and publishes extensively in news and lifestyle platforms internationally. Her articles are well known for their thought provoking, innovative ideas regarding children, family and digital lifestyles. Her articles always provide balanced and informed analysis, and practical solutions. Dr Jo is interviewed extensively by the press, and her commentary and analysis is featured regularly in publications globally. Dr Jo is a published book author and is currently working on her 3rd book examining our digital lifestyle.

Themes that Dr Jo writes and provide analysis and commentary on include: video games, social media, online safety, insider perspectives on kid’s digital lifestyle, digital family life, screen time, technology and learning, and new changes and challenges that emerge from children’s technology use.
